awk命名是 对文件进行按列处理并输出。例如对如下文件,想要输出第一列包含字母A的行,可以这样操作:
A01 11816617 11818996 D01 10299861 10302381
A01 12483751 12489408 A13 91812585 91816268
A01 12483751 12489408 D01 11125181 11129035
A01 12483751 12489408 D13 45120626 45124469
A02 175083 177257 D02 300744 302881
A02 57261319 57264760 D03 30873876 30875907
A02 96290827 96291949 D03 2429444 2430580
A02 96290827 96291949 D11 23889507 23890696
A04 80125821 80129362 D04 49174022 49176990
A05 6059838 6061188 A07 3685383 3686653
awk '$1 ~ /A/ {print }' ./data/WRKY.link.txt
~ 代表匹配, /A/ 这里可以使用正则表达式,可以处理更复杂的匹配。
此外,我们在网易云课堂上有各种教学视频,有兴趣可以了解一下:
1. 文章越来越难发?是你没发现新思路,基因家族分析发2-4分文章简单快速,学习链接:基因家族分析实操课程
2. 转录组数据理解不深入?图表看不懂?点击链接学习深入解读数据结果文件,学习链接:转录组(有参)结果解读;转录组(无参)结果解读
3. 转录组数据深入挖掘技能-WGCNA,提升你的文章档次,学习链接:WGCNA-加权基因共表达网络分析
4. 转录组数据怎么挖掘?学习链接:转录组标准分析后的数据挖掘
6. 更多学习内容:linux、perl、R语言画图,更多免费课程请点击以下链接:
如果觉得我的文章对您有用,请随意打赏。你的支持将鼓励我继续创作!